Transaction a86598f756107f5d30f4f5352f0cedbfeaeb5f1348419c336bda445f4944b71c
1 Input
1 Output
-
a86598f756107f5d30f4f5352f0cedbfeaeb5f1348419c336bda445f4944b71c:0
- value
- 25409
- script pubkey
- OP_0 OP_PUSHBYTES_20 3df7b7a64f1ba6aafa9c42071146ddc56bf7efda
- address
- bc1q8hmm0fj0rwn2475uggr3z3kac44l0m76wlns6a